A metallic, clattering, or knocking sound emanating from the power plant during periods of increased speed signifies a potential mechanical issue within the vehicle’s propulsion system. This auditory symptom often correlates with conditions that require immediate diagnostic attention and repair.
Addressing unusual sounds originating from the motor during speed increases is vital for maintaining vehicle longevity and preventing further, more costly damage. Historically, these types of noises have served as an early warning signal, allowing vehicle operators to identify and correct issues before they escalate into major component failures. Doing so ensures continued performance, preserves engine efficiency, and contributes to overall safety.
